Rename LOread() and LOwrite() to be lower case to allow use

in case-insensitive SQL. Define LOread() and LOwrite() as macros
 to avoid having to update calls everywhere.

#ifndef BE_FSSTUBS_H
#define BE_FSSTUBS_H
/* Redefine names LOread() and LOwrite() to be lowercase to allow calling
* using the new v6.1 case-insensitive SQL parser. Define macros to allow
* the existing code to stay the same. - tgl 97/05/03
*/
#define LOread(f,l) loread(f,l)
#define LOwrite(f,b) lowrite(f,b)
